Accelerating SDGs: 5 Lessons Learned from UN Philippines' Civil Society GatheringAs the world works towards achieving the ambitious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) by 2030, it is more crucial than ever for civil society organizations (CSOs) to collaborate with the United Nations (UN) in driving progress. Recently, the UN Philippines brought together a diverse group of CSO leaders from across the country to accelerate the SDG agenda rollout by 2025. In this blog post, we will distill the top 5 takeaways from this gathering and explore how they can inform our collective efforts as professionals in achieving the SDGs.Lesson #1: Collaboration is KeyThe UN Philippines' civil society gathering highlighted the importance of collaboration in driving progress towards the SDGs. By bringing together diverse stakeholders, CSOs, government agencies, and international organizations, we can create a robust network that amplifies our collective impact. As professionals, this lesson serves as a potent reminder to engage with fellow creatives, entrepreneurs, and changemakers to co-create innovative solutions that benefit our shared humanity.Lesson #2: Data-Driven Insights are EssentialIn today's data-driven world, insights gathered from various sources can provide the crucial foundation for informed decision-making. The UN Philippines' gathering emphasized the need for robust data collection and analysis to track progress towards the SDGs. As professionals, we must recognize that our work should be grounded in empirical evidence, ensuring that our artistic expressions are not only aesthetically pleasing but also rooted in facts and figures.Lesson #3: Inclusive Participation is VitalThe SDG agenda rollout emphasizes the need for inclusive participation from all stakeholders. The UN Philippines' civil society gathering demonstrated the importance of involving marginalized communities, grassroots organizations, and local authorities in decision-making processes. As professionals, we must strive to create art that reflects the diversity of human experience, amplifying voices often overlooked or underrepresented.Lesson #4: Creativity is a Powerful CatalystThe UN Philippines' gathering showcased the transformative potential of creativity in driving social change. By embracing innovative and out-of-the-box thinking, CSOs can develop novel solutions to complex problems. As professionals, we're uniquely positioned to harness our creative energies to craft artistic expressions that inspire, educate, and mobilize others towards achieving the SDGs.Lesson #5: Accountability is CrucialThe UN Philippines' gathering underscored the importance of accountability in ensuring that progress towards the SDGs is measurable, reportable, and verifiable. As professionals, we must commit to transparently tracking our impact, reporting on our successes and challenges, and adjusting our approaches as needed.In conclusion, the UN Philippines' civil society gathering offers valuable lessons for CSOs, government agencies, and international organizations seeking to accelerate progress towards the SDGs. By embracing collaboration, data-driven insights, inclusive participation, creativity, and accountability, we can collectively harness our energies to co-create a better future for all.
